Frequently Asked Questions

What types of huts and shelters can I find in Wustvieler Forst?

Wustvieler Forst primarily offers basic resting spots for hikers, often including seating and access to natural features. You'll find rustic shelters, kiosks, and natural resting places. For more established huts with amenities, the nearby Rhön Mountains offer additional options, though they are geographically distinct from Wustvieler Forst.

Are there family-friendly huts in Wustvieler Forst?

Yes, several huts in the area are suitable for families. For example, the Saint Francis Statue and Wine Pavilion at Alten Berg offers a pleasant rest area with an unexpected view. Another great option is the Frey am Zabelstein Kiosk and Pavilion, which is open on weekends and public holidays, providing drinks and small dishes.

Which huts offer facilities like food or drinks?

The Bauken Herz Hut at Zabelstein is a rustic hut managed on weekends, offering various drinks, cakes, and sausages. Similarly, the Frey am Zabelstein Kiosk and Pavilion provides cold and hot drinks, along with small dishes from the grill on weekends and public holidays.

Where can I find huts with good viewpoints in Wustvieler Forst?

For stunning views, visit the Saint Francis Statue and Wine Pavilion at Alten Berg, which overlooks vineyards and the Steigerwald. The Frey am Zabelstein Kiosk and Pavilion also offers a great spot for a rest with views on the Zabelstein.

Are there any hidden or unique huts worth discovering?

The Bauken Herz Hut at Zabelstein is described as a rustic, somewhat hidden destination near the Zabelstein castle ruins. It's managed on weekends and offers a unique experience with drinks and small meals.

What is the best time of year to visit the huts in Wustvieler Forst?

As a predominantly forested area, Wustvieler Forst is enjoyable year-round.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ures and beautiful foliage, while summer is ideal for longer hikes. Some huts, like the Bauken Herz Hut and Frey am Zabelstein Kiosk, are managed or open primarily on weekends, so checking their operating hours is advisable.

What do visitors enjoy most about the huts and shelters in Wustvieler Forst?

Visitors appreciate the unexpected views after climbs, the inviting rest areas, and the convenience of shelters like the Murrleinsnest Hut for breaks or to shelter from rain. The rustic charm and the opportunity to enjoy local refreshments at places like the Bauken Herz Hut at Zabelstein are also highly valued.

Is there a hut that provides access to a natural spring?

Yes, the Donkey Spring is a notable natural monument with a rustic log cabin and large seating area. It features an old spring connection, historically used for drinking water, and is a welcome stop for hikers.

Are there any historical sites near the huts in Wustvieler Forst?

Yes, the Bauken Herz Hut at Zabelstein is located near the Zabelstein castle ruins, which was once considered a significant fortress. The Saint Francis Statue and Wine Pavilion at Alten Berg also offers a cultural element with its statue overlooking the landscape.
